sorry ... thank you for answering nobdysfoolRT is Van's shorthand for Reformed Theology, which is often equated with Calvinism, although there are some differences. Covenant Theology would be another nearly equivalent term.

John 1:5 is often mistranslated to read the darkness did not comprehend the light, but that is completely wrong. What the verse says if the light shines in the darkness and the darkness does not overcome it. The Greek word (katalambano) means "to take down" so "overcome" is a sound translation. Light overcomes darkness.
